Chickenbristle Woodworks 2021 Openback Banjo w/frailing scoop
About 30 miles southwest of Champaign, IL, and alongside the Kaskaskia River, is an area known as Chickenbristle. Chickenbristle Woodworks is a local shop there in rural Douglas County. Most parts of these instruments were individually hand crafted by a group of friends and music-lvoers trying to put together the finest playing banjos they could make. These banjos are built with the best quality parts from manufacturers such as Deering, Remo, Gotoh, LMI, etc.
Bob made the wooden parts mostly from trees that grew on his property. The black walnut tree was felled and milled in 2010, then air-dried in his woodshed until 2021-along with the homegrown osage orange, maple, and cherry. The cherry tree grew right next to the Kaskaskia river, and had been one of his favorite climbing trees when it was still growing. Bob has been playing banjos for more than 50 years, and building various musical instruments (with help from friends) for more than 30 years. Ed contributed to the planning and designing of these openback banjos, along with doing a lot of brass drilling and tapping. The final sanding, fret dressing, finishing, assembly and setup are Ed's expertise. Scotty jumped on board and volunteered to shape and polish all those brass banjo shoes.

SPECS:
- Solid brass rolled tone ring
- High quality Gotoh planetary tuning machines and geared 5th string tuner
- Remo Renaissance 11" banjo head
- Notched brass handmade tension hoop
- 23 nickel plated steel tension hooks with 5/16"
- Solid brass handmade banjo shoes with stainless steel buttonhead screws
- Vega-style nickel plated brass armrest
- Kerchner tailpiece - nickel plated
- Royal Blackwood fingerboard - 24" scale
- Hard Alloy "EVO Gold" frets:
- 22 frets plus a "zero fret" (non scooped neck) or
- 17 frets plus a "zero fret" (neck with a frailing scoop)
- Fingerboard inlays
- mother of pearl - fret 5,12,17
- turquoise - fret 3,7,10,15
- side dot position inlays
- Bone Nut
- German-made 3-leg banjo bridge - maple and ebony
- "Chickenbristle Crescent Moon" Abalone and Blackwood Peghead Inlay
- Hand-Carved black walnut neck with center laminations
- cherry/osage orange/cherry
- Two-way adjustable and removable truss rod
- Easy-adjust neck design with neck extension through the rim to the tail
- 5-ply solid walnut rum w/ osage orange rim cap
- Osage orange heel cap
- Natural clear satin poly finish (only lemon oil on fingerboard)
- Hardshell Openback Banjo Case
